Pipeline stress analysts normally carry out pipe stress evaluation using the soil stamina values offered by geotechnical designers. These worths indicate the anxiety degree the soil can tolerate without going through too much deformations.

Overstating the load-bearing ability also a lot can result in too much deformation or even failing of the pipeline in severe problems. On the other hand, undervaluing the soil's load-bearing capacity can lead to using an overdesigned pipeline. In conditions where pipeline failings do occur, forensic geotechnical engineers check out whether the soil stamina was evaluated sufficiently and whether the design team overestimated the load-bearing capacity of the dirts in the pipe zone.

Each terrain presents specific difficulties for the style and building of the pipe. Since the design of pipelines requires to be constant with the geologic terrain, the shear stamina of the dirt is a crucial consider assessing pipe movement on sloping locations. In comparison, dirt dilatancy (the propensity of dirt to broaden when sheared) have to be made up in seismic zones to avoid extreme tensions on the pipeline throughout a quake.

Picking the appropriate pipe installation technique for some areas of the pipe route can be crucial to making sure long-term performance and security, whereas picking an inappropriate installation technique could cause failing. For example, selecting an open-cut setup technique as opposed to horizontal directional drilling (HDD) in an area with deep natural down payments can increase the probability of upheaval buckling and pipeline failing.

If these two groups fail to interact efficiently, slipups regarding soil stamina or pipe load-bearing capability may result in unforeseen pipeline failings. Overestimated dirt toughness parameters, for instance, might lead stress and anxiety experts to under-design a pipeline for the variety of forces put on it throughout its lifespan. Alternatively, where the soil is thought to be weaker than it really is, the pipe may be overdesigned, bring about unnecessary prices and more strength.
